The bank statement balance is $ 4 800 and shows a service charge of $ 14​, interest earned of $ 6​, and an NSF cheque for $ 400. Deposits in transit total $ 1100​; outstanding cheques are $ 575. The bookkeeper recorded as $ 160 a cheque of $ 138 in payment of an account payable.

Answer #1

Bank statement balance =$4,800

Add: deposits in transit =$1100

Less: outstanding checks 575

Adjusted bank balance =$5,325

2. Adjusted balance balance is equal to adjusted book balance

Adjusted book balance =$5325

Add service charge =$14

Less interest earned 6

Add NSF check 400

Add error 22

Book balance before reconciliation =$5,755
